How Reservations Work at Le Bistroquet

Le Bistroquet's rise in popularity means its tables vanish quicker than a macaron at a Parisian tea party. Reservations are made exclusively through Resy, and if you think you can just waltz in any evening, think again.

"Persistent diners have cracked the code: timing, flexibility, and a dash of tech-savvy patience."

How to Get a Reservation at Le Bistroquet

  1. Know When They Drop: Reservations typically open up 14 days in advance at midnight. Mark your calendar, set an alarm, and have your Resy app ready.
  1. Optimal Party Size: If possible, aim to reserve for 2-4 people. Larger groups face stiffer competition and fewer available slots.
  1. Cancellation Sweet Spot: Check back at 3 PM and 5 PM for last-minute openings from cancellations. Many diners finalize their evening plans around these times.
  1. Go Solo for Bar Seats: If you're feeling spontaneous, try for a bar seat during weekday evenings — they're generally first-come, first-served.

The Walk-In Strategy

If you've struck out on reservations, there's a silver lining. Arrive early for lunch or late for dinner to try your luck as a walk-in. The key is flexibility — and a charming smile doesn't hurt.
